Fire Engulfs Four-Storey House in Srinagar


Srinagar: A residential house in the Batamaloo area of Srinagar district in Indian-administered Jammu and Kashmir was severely damaged after a fire erupted, leaving the four-storey building partially gutted.



According to a statement by Kashmir Media Service, the incident occurred in SD Colony, where the fire quickly spread through the structure. Local residents acted swiftly upon discovering the blaze, attempting to extinguish the flames before emergency services arrived.



The exact cause of the fire remains unknown, prompting police to register a case and begin investigations into the incident. While no casualties have been reported, the damage to the property is extensive.



Authorities have urged residents to remain cautious and have assured the community that findings from the investigation will be communicated promptly.
